In modern Chilean civil engineering, door hardware is not merely an aesthetic choice; it is a critical component of building code compliance. According to the Ordenanza General de Urbanismo y Construcción (OGUC), public access doors must meet strict safety, egress, and accessibility protocols. In addition, Chile’s high-frequency seismic activity subjects building frames to lateral and vertical shifts. Standard hinges concentrate door weight on two or three local points, accelerating sag and door alignment failure when structural shifting occurs.
Continuous geared hinges solve this vulnerability. By distributing the door’s weight along the entire height of the frame, these hinges minimize stress on the door assembly, absorb vibration, and maintain smooth operation even after mild seismic events. Coastal urban centers and heavy industrial mining structures are subjected to high levels of atmospheric humidity, airborne chlorides, and harsh chemicals. Under these conditions, iron, standard steel, or lower-grade hardware will rust and seize. LVXING addresses this challenge by utilizing premium-grade extruded 6063-T6 aluminum alloy, sourced from Fenglu. Every hinge undergoes a rigorous anodizing process that creates a thick, protective oxide layer conforming to Class I anodizing specifications. This treatment guarantees superior resistance to salt-fog environments, exceeding standard ASTM B117 salt spray tests, which is essential for installation in northern mining facilities and coastal maritime hubs.

In seismic zones like Santiago or Valparaíso, structural shifts can easily warp door frames, causing doors to stick or drag. Continuous geared hinges distribute the weight of the door along the entire frame, which absorbs movement and maintains alignment. This prevents emergency exit doors from jamming during low-intensity seismic events.
For seaside locations like San Antonio or Coquimbo, we recommend a Class I clear or colored anodized finish (0.7 mil / 18 microns or thicker). This provides excellent defense against atmospheric salt, preventing oxidation and maintaining smooth gear operation over decades.
